Output 150bdc4ae05686e2023da71b4eb2f180b005bdaa292c1919ffd3cd33e12be928:0

value
62017328
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22efd2e104b082753c12e30494aa3ee9494e13a1 OP_EQUALVERIFY OP_CHECKSIG
address
14BjGmZLWXBREA4rU4aKpAVFrEiAQxDuVS
transaction
150bdc4ae05686e2023da71b4eb2f180b005bdaa292c1919ffd3cd33e12be928
confirmations
433370
spent
true